Sensors are pivotal components in contemporary electronic systems, enabling devices to interact with their environment. From automotive to smart home applications, the demand for advanced sensors is rapidly increasing.
There are numerous types of sensors, each serving different purposes. Temperature sensors monitor heat levels, while accelerometers detect motion. In industrial settings, pressure sensors are vital for monitoring machinery performance, while proximity sensors enhance safety features in automotive applications.
With the advent of the Internet of Things (IoT), sensors are becoming increasingly interconnected. This connectivity allows for real-time data collection and analysis, leading to smarter decision-making processes in various industries. Businesses that leverage IoT technology can optimize processes and enhance operational efficiency.
Despite advancements, sensor technology faces challenges such as miniaturization and energy efficiency. Manufacturers are constantly seeking innovative solutions to produce smaller, more efficient sensors without compromising accuracy.
The future of sensors is promising, with trends indicating a move towards multifunctional sensors that can perform multiple tasks concurrently. Additionally, advancements in artificial intelligence will further enhance sensor capabilities, leading to more intelligent electronic systems.
